igb_uio: fix build with lock down checks

Caught on ubuntu-16.04 with hwe kernel for aarch64:

$ uname -a
Linux ubuntu1604arm64es 4.13.0-43-generic #48~16.04.1-Ubuntu SMP Thu May
17 13:08:01 UTC 2018 aarch64 aarch64 aarch64 GNU/Linux

== Build kernel/linux/igb_uio
  CC [M] .../kernel/linux/igb_uio/igb_uio.o
In file included from .../kernel/linux/igb_uio/igb_uio.c:20:0:
.../igb_uio/compat.h: In function ‘igbuio_kernel_is_locked_down’:
.../igb_uio/compat.h:146:7:
error: "CONFIG_EFI_SECURE_BOOT_LOCK_DOWN" is not defined [-Werror=undef]
 #elif CONFIG_EFI_SECURE_BOOT_LOCK_DOWN
       ^
cc1: all warnings being treated as errors

Fixes: d67014c3d38b ("igb_uio: fail and log if kernel lock down is enabled")
